Marie-Zoé and Pierre were married at Notre-Dame de Montréal on November 18th, 1834. The style of her dress suggests a date of 1830 – 1835, leading to speculation that this pendant was perhaps commissioned in celebration of their engagement. The artist, Roy-Audy, settled in the Montreal area circa 1833 – 1834, often plying his portraiture skills to members of the lower middle class, such as the Persillier dits Lachapelles.
